"Survivor’s Best Friend (SBF) is a registered nonprofit that rescues shelter animals while at the same time empowering survivors of sexual assault and domestic violence. SBF pays for all adoption expenses for a shelter dog or cat of a survivor’s choosing. These expenses cover not only the cost of the animal, but also up-to-date vaccinations, veterinary exams, and spaying/neutering procedures.
SBF also funds the medical costs associated with getting adopted pets to become Emotional Support Animals (ESAs). Medical providers must write a letter verifying that pet owners suffer from a psychological disorder for which adopted pets provide relief. Additionally, we provide long-term support to help survivors and adopted pets thrive together.
We fund adoptions and ESA letters for pets across the country and help survivors of sexual assault and/or domestic violence who are able to care for an animal regardless of sex, gender, race, age, ability, religion, sexual orientation, or any other facet of identity. We believe in intersectionality and aim to be a resource for all survivors."
